Cost of Capital
The rate of return a company must pay to its shareholders and debt holders, representing the cost of obtaining funds to finance its operations.
Long-Term Funds
Investments or sources of financing that are provided or required for a duration exceeding one year.
Acquisition of Assets
The process by which a company purchases or obtains assets, such as property, equipment, or other resources, to enhance its business operations.
Target Capital Structure
The mix of debt, equity, and other financing methods a company aims to use to fund its operations and growth.
